Soil Compaction Essentials: Choosing the Right tool

When it comes to soil compaction, selecting the appropriate instrument is paramount for achieving optimal results. The type of tractor you choose will depend on factors such as the scope of your project, the character of the soil, and the aimed-for compaction level.

  • For smaller areas, a handheld compactor might be suitable. These tools are transferable and straightforward to maneuver.
  • Larger undertakings will likely demand a powered compactor. These units offer greater strength and can cover space more quickly.
  • Consider the kind of soil you're working with. Sandy soils dense easily, while clay soils may require a more powerful compactor.

Ultimately, the best way to choose the appropriate soil compaction equipment is to speak with with a qualified professional. They can evaluate your demands and suggest the most suitable solution.

Comprehending Plate Compactors and Their Applications

Plate compactors serve as essential tools in the construction industry. These powerful machines densify soil layers, creating a stable foundation for various buildings. Plate compactors employ a vibrating plate that transmits force to the ground, effectively consolidating the material.

Their applications extend a wide range of tasks, including:

* Preparing construction sites for laying foundations.

* Compacting gravel and soil for roads and driveways.

* Strengthening embankments and slopes.

Additionally, plate compactors are here valuable in landscaping projects, such as leveling ground surfaces for lawns and gardens. The adaptability of plate compactors makes them an indispensable resource for both large-scale construction and smaller-scale tasks.
